What is Apigenin?
Apigenin is a bioflavonoid that not only supports general wellness but also plays a critical role in modulating various biological functions. It has been found to restore the richness and diversity of gut microbiota, which is crucial for maintaining an optimal balance in bodily functions and metabolic processes.
This plant-derived compound is commonly found in parsley, celery, chamomile, and certain citrus fruits. 4. Enhanced Cellular Function and Longevity
Apigenin is a natural inhibitor of CD38, an enzyme that breaks down NAD+ (n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ide). NAD+ is a vital molecule that supports cellular repair, energy production, and longevity. As we age, NAD+ levels decline, contributing to fatigue, cognitive decline, and reduced metabolic efficiency.
By inhibiting CD38, Apigenin helps preserve NAD+ levels, enhancing mitochondrial health, cellular energy, and DNA repair. This makes it a powerful tool in promoting healthy aging and overall vitality.
The Role of Apigenin in Sleep and Hormonal Health
Sleep Regulation and Improved Sleep Quality
Good sleep is a cornerstone of health, affecting everything from metabolism to cognitive function. Apigenin has been studied for its ability to promote relaxation and improve sleep quality. Its presence in chamomile tea, a well-known natural sleep aid, highlights its role as a mild sedative.
Apigenin interacts with GABA receptors in the brain, which are responsible for promoting calmness and reducing anxiety. By enhancing GABA activity, Apigenin may help individuals fall asleep faster and enjoy deeper, more restorative sleep.
This is particularly beneficial for people experiencing insomnia, stress-related sleep disturbances, or irregular sleep patterns due to shift work or hormonal imbalances.
